看板 Python 關於我們 聯絡資訊
批改娘上有一題是希望輸出格式化的金字塔 但我怎麼弄格式都不OK QQ 這是題目希望輸出的樣子: 最右邊都沒有空白!! * * * * * * * * * * 但我的程式碼如下: a = eval(input()) for i in range(a): for j in range(a-i-1): print("2",end="") for k in range(i+1): print("*",end=" ") print("") 這樣的話雖然都很像(輸出2是我在練習時方便數空白數是否正確) 但我最右邊一定都會有空白 想請問該怎麼解決 再拜託各位大神幫幫忙了!! -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 1.161.162.90 ※ 文章網址: https://www.ptt.cc/bbs/Python/M.1494173563.A.FE9.html
losepacific: print("*", end="") if k == i else print("*",end= 05/08 01:45
losepacific: "2") 05/08 01:46
zerof: strip, 實際上用一個 for 就可以了 05/08 10:29
HarryCHIT: 看來是同學..私信給我mail,我把我的mail給你參考 05/10 12:35